Kullandığım Fedora sürümünü nasıl bulabilirim?


116
sudo find /etc | xargs grep -i fedora > searchFedora

verir:

/etc/netplug.d/netplug: # At least on Fedora Core 1
...

Ancak /etc/netplug.d/netplugdosyadaki Fedora sürümüne bakın . Ciddi mi?



@ Fuser97381: Bu doğru değil. Küratörlük önemlidir ve küratörlük Google aracılığıyla gerçekleşmez.
Orbit'te Hafiflik Yarışları

1
@LightnessRacesinOrbit False. İçerik oluşturucuların emeğiyle geçimini sağlayan sitelerin sahipleri için küratörlük (küratörlük değil, wtf) önemli olabilir, ancak kullanıcılar, her iki siteyi de indeksleyen google aracılığıyla bilgileri bulur, bu yüzden onlar için önemli değildir.
Darth Egregious

@ Fuser97381: Onlar için önemli olmadığını biliyorum, ama hiç önemli olmadığını ima ettin, ki bu yanlış.
Orbit'te Hafiflik Yarışları

1
cat /etc/fedora-release/
Seraf

Yanıtlar:


146
cat /etc/issue

Veya cat /etc/fedora-release@Bruce ONeel tarafından önerildiği gibi


Teşekkürler, Indeed bir Red Hat Enterprise Linux AS sürüm 4'tür (Nahant Güncellemesi 5)
pindare

10
Ancak, oturum açma banner'larını biri değiştirdiyse bu işe yaramaz… Ben genellikle benimkini düzenlerim ve öyle görünüyor ki, pek çok (çoğu) kurumsal BT departmanı
yapıyorum

8
Bu yanlış bir cevap. @BruceONeel'in cevabı doğru cevap olarak kabul edilmelidir
Igor Chubin

5
Fedora 26'da çalışmıyor. Ancak Bruce'un cevabı işe yarıyor.
Leo Ufimtsev

9
\S Kernel \r on an \m (\l)
MariuszS

136

Ayrıca deneyebilirsiniz /etc/redhat-releaseveya /etc/fedora-release:

cat /etc/fedora-release 
Fedora release 7 (Moonshine)

16
cat /etc/redhat-releasebenim için de çalışıyor, ancak daha iyi cat /etc/os-releaseolan, gerçekten ayrıntılı bilgi veriyor.
Olivier Faucheux


20

Size ihtiyacınız olanı verebilecek en basit komut, ancak diğer bazı iyi bilgiler de şudur:

hostnamectl

1
Bu kesinlikle en uygun cevap ve aynı zamanda acıyı da gösteriyor. Güzel!
Joshua Sleeper

20

Deneyebilirsin

lsb_release -a

En azından Debian ve Ubuntu üzerinde çalışan (ve LSB olduğu için, kesinlikle en azından diğer ana dağıtımların çoğunda olmalı). http://rpmfind.net/linux/RPM/sourceforge/l/ls/lsb/lsb_release-1.0-1.i386.html , oldukça uzun bir süredir olduğunu gösteriyor.


1
Bu pakette var redhat-lsb, iş yerinde benim kutuyu varsayılan olarak yüklü değildi (Fedora 15) en az (kurumsal BT? Başarısız) ama benim evde Fedora 16 kutu üzerinde oldu. (Varsayılan paket olup olmadığından emin değilim)
BRPocock

1
Veya lsb_release -ddaha kısa bir çıktı için.
ROMANIA_engineer

8
cat /etc/*release

Neredeyse tüm büyük dağıtımlar için evrenseldir.


1
Bu çok doğrudur! Bu komut hemen hemen her Linux dağıtımında kullanılabilir.
specialk1

6
[Belmiro@HP-550 ~]$ uname -a

Linux HP-550 2.6.30.10-105.2.23.fc11.x86_64 #1 SMP Thu Feb 11 07:06:34 UTC 2010
x86_64 x86_64 x86_64 GNU/Linux


[Belmiro@HP-550 ~]$ lsb_release -a

LSB Version: :core-3.1-amd64:core-3.1-noarch:core-3.2-amd64:core-3.2-noarch:deskt
op-3.1-amd64:desktop-3.1-noarch:desktop-3.2-amd64:desktop-3.2-noarch
Distributor ID: Fedora
Description: Fedora release 11 (Leonidas)
Release: 11
Codename: Leonidas
[Belmiro@HP-550 ~]$ 

5

Peki ya uname -a?


Bu, farklı bir FC veya RHEL sürümünden olabilecek Linux çekirdeği sürümünü verir. Çekirdeği değiştirirseniz, işletim sisteminin / etc / issue tarafından bildirilen kalması tartışmalıdır, ama işte buradasınız. :)
David Grant

uname -a dağıtıma değil, işletim sistemi için çekirdek, ağ, makine, işlemci, donanım ve GNU / Linux verir! Bu yeterli değil.
pindare

uname -a on fedora 19: Linux ana bilgisayar adı 3.11.4-201.fc19.x86_64 # 1 SMP Per 10 Ekim 14:11:18 UTC 2013 x86_64 x86_64 x86_64 GNU / Linux fedora çekirdeği, dosya adına şu şekilde gömülü fedora sürümüne sahiptir: görebilirsiniz :) fedora 20'ye yükselttikten sonra bu komutu yeniden çalıştıracak (fedup, atm çalıştırıyor, çekirdek dosya
adının

Linux ana bilgisayar adı 3.11.4-301.fc20.x86_64 # 1 SMP 10 Ekim 15:09:17 UTC 2013 x86_64 x86_64 x86_64 GNU / Linux, fedora 20'yi güncellemek için fedup-cli çalıştırıldıktan sonra uname -a çıktısını verir.
jascha

5

Bu komutlar Artik 10 için çalıştı:

  • cat / etc / fedora-release
  • cat / etc / issue
  • hostnamectl

ve diğerleri yapmadı:

  • lsb_release -a
  • uname -a

2

Fedora 25 (iş istasyonu) yüklememde, tüm dağıtım kimliği bilgileri bu dosyada bulundu:

/usr/lib/os.release.d/os-release-workstation 

Bu dahil,

  • ADI = Fedora
  • VERSION = "25 (İş İstasyonu Sürümü)"
  • İD fötr =
  • Version_id = 25
  • PRETTY_NAME = "Fedora 25 (İş İstasyonu Sürümü)"
  • <...>
  • VARIANT = "İş İstasyonu Sürümü"
  • VARIANT_ID = iş istasyonu

0

uname -a benim fc11 ile çalışır

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.